[Federal Register Volume 63, Number 214 (Thursday, November 5, 1998)] [Notices] [Page 59761] From the Federal Register Online via the Government Publishing Office [www.gpo.gov] [FR Doc No: 98-29697] ======================================================================= ----------------------------------------------------------------------- COMMISSION ON CIVIL RIGHTS Agenda and Notice of Public Meeting of the Alaska Advisory Committee Notice is hereby given, pursuant to the provisions of the rules and regulations of the U.S. Commission on Civil Rights, that a meeting of the Alaska Advisory Committee to the Commission will convene at 1 p.m. and adjourn at 3 p.m. on November 19, 1998, at the Anchorage Hilton, 500 West Third Avenue, Anchorage, Alaska 99501. The purpose of the meeting is to discuss civil rights issues and review a special education draft report.
